View PostComradeRedXv2, on 05 August 2010 - 06:05 PM, said:

well, suspension wise, what was different on the 5th and 6th gens? just curious


Everything. Cradle, struts, knuckles, swaybars. basically the whole design.



****The only suspension item that will work on 5th and 6th gens is rear trailing arms****
